Places to live if you commute to Waterloo UK towns & villages recommended by us Top locations by % of residents in high income jobsThe property market in Sleepshyde has had a steep increase over the last few years and accelerating growth. On average, a detached house costs £1,221,641, which is up 1.9% on last year. A semi-detached house on average costs £741,427, a terraced house £542,301 and a flat £326,099. Renting a two bedroom flat will cost you £1,262 per month. Property prices in Sleepshyde are a little higher than the average property prices across Hertfordshire and are much higher compared to other locations with a similar density in England. When looking at the annual change in property prices in Sleepshyde, prices have risen much more quickly than the annual average price change seen across the Hertfordshire region.
Property data is based on St Albans level pricing data and is as at September 2023 (publicised 15 November 2023)

Relative to the UK as a whole, Hertfordshire has an average crime rate (64 crimes reported per thousand people). Sleepshyde has a consistent crime rate as this, with 61 crimes reported per thousand people. In regards to burglaries, Sleepshyde has a lower rate (3 burglaries per thousand people) than an average location in the UK with the same density. Source: ONS
